What Every First-Time Homebuyer Needs to Know

When you’re buying your first home, there are many things to think about and prepare for. It can be a daunting task, but you can make it a smooth and successful experience with the right knowledge and preparation. Here’s everything a first-time homebuyer needs to know:

How to save money

There are a lot of upfront costs when buying a home, so it’s essential to start saving as early as possible. Here are some tips on how to save money for a down payment:

Cut back on unnecessary spending

When you’re trying to save money, every bit counts. Take a close look at your monthly expenses and see where you can cut back. Maybe you can downgrade your cable package or pack a lunch instead of eating out every day.

Create a budget and stick to it

Creating a budget is a great way to keep track of your spending and make sure you’re not overspending on unnecessary items. Make sure you allow for a monthly savings goal and stick to it!

Look for ways to reduce your monthly expenses

There are many ways to reduce your monthly expenses, like refinancing your mortgage, switching to a cheaper energy provider, or carpooling to work. Take a look at your budget and see where you can make some changes.

Invest in a high-yield savings account or certificate of deposit

If you don’t want to keep your money in a checking account where it can be easily accessed, consider investing in a high-yield savings account or certificate of deposit. This will give you a little extra return on your investment and help you save money faster.

What to look for when house hunting

It’s important to know what you’re looking for when house hunting because it can help you save time and money. Here are a few things to keep in mind:

The right location

Think about what’s important to you in a location. Do you want to be close to the city, or is a quiet suburb more your style? Consider your commute, schools in the area, and other amenities that are important to you.

The right size

Think about how much space you need and what kind of layout you’re looking for. Do you want a lot of bedrooms and bathrooms, or is a smaller home more your style? Think about your lifestyle and how much space you’ll need to live in comfortably.

The right price

Don’t forget to consider your budget when house hunting. You don’t want to fall in love with a home that’s out of your price range. Shop around and get an idea of what homes in your area are selling for.

The right features

Think about the features you want in a home. Are you looking for a home with a backyard or one with an extra bedroom for guests? Consider the features that are important to you and make a list.

How to prepare for the home loan process

There are many things to think about when taking out a home loan. Here are some tips on how to prepare:

Check your credit score and get any errors corrected

Whenever you apply for a loan, the lenders will look at different factors to assess your creditworthiness and eligibility, your credit score included. That’s why you have to make sure that you check your credit score and get any errors corrected so you have the best chance of being approved.

Save up for closing costs and other expenses

Closing costs can vary depending on the lender and the state you live in, but typically they range from 2-5% of the purchase price. Make sure you save up to $5,000 for closing costs and other expenses like moving costs.

Get pre-approved for a loan

It’s a good idea to get pre-approved for a loan before you start house hunting. This will help you know how much you can afford and save you time when you’re ready to buy. You can find a reliable mortgage loan officer who can help you get pre-approved.

Shop around for the best interest rate

Interest rates can vary from lender to lender, so it’s essential to shop around to find the best rate for you. This can save you a lot of money over the life of your loan since your interest rate is one of the biggest factors in your monthly payments.

Learn about the different types of home loans available

There are different types of home loans available, so it’s essential to know about the best ones for you. Some of the most popular types of home loans are fixed-rate mortgages and adjustable-rate mortgages because they offer stability and flexibility.
